undigested
英['ʌndɪ'dʒestɪd]
美[ˌʌndə'dʒestɪd]
- adj. 未消化的;未充分理解的;未售出的
详细释义
Adjective:
-
not thought over and arranged systematically in the mind; not absorbed or assimilated mentally;
"an undigested mass of facts gathered at random"
-
not digested;
"undigested food"
